There is no greater ‘achievement’ than God realization. Rest all is trivial. So in secular world whatever minor achievements I may have had, may have just created ego escalation and bondage. Why ? Because the happiness I thought I may get from them was ephemeral.

I was always trying to be somebody . Now I am taking baby steps to be become nobody (egoless).

— “from somebody to nobody is a journey!” ( Swami Ishwarananda in Pathways to Peace)

Gratefully, in recent years, becoming a student of Vedanta is slowly changing my vision though the guidance of scriptures brought by my guru. Now I try to look for higher purpose in what I do. I am trying to develop prasaad buddhi. I am striving to do my best, and leave the rest. The achievements that come from such vision have been much more meaningful.

No worldly achievements will give me permanent happiness though. If I keep on looking for this outside, I may keep on sinking and floating on and off. Though I know it intellectually yet I also have to ‘ FEEL’ that I’m of the nature of JOY. That will be the best achievement ever- to Know Myself, Self Realization, rediscover the Divine within.
